Administrador de Banco de Dados - Sênior
CRP Tech
CRP Tech
FADEL TRANSPORTES
FADEL TRANSPORTES
FADEL TRANSPORTES
Digisystem
inventCloud
CRP Tech
Não Informado
Remoto
Não Informado
Deseja trabalhar em uma empresa que respira tecnologia, oferece novos desafios e um ambiente de trabalho de constante desenvolvimento profissional?
Confira o perfil abaixo e candidate-se!
Formação: Superior completo em Ciência da Computação, Engenharia da Computação, Sistemas de Informação ou áreas afins.
Experiência Obrigatória para a vaga:
• Mínimo de 5 anos de experiência comprovada atuando especificamente como Administrador de Banco de Dados.
Conhecimento técnicos obrigatórios da vaga:
• Domínio de Banco de Dados Oracle (11g, 12c, 19c ou superior) e/ou PostgreSQL (versões 11 ou superior).
• Experiência com modelagem de dados (conceitual, lógica e física), utilizando ferramentas como ERwin, Oracle SQL Developer Data Modeler, pgModeler ou equivalentes.
• Escrita de SQL avançado, incluindo subqueries, CTEs, views, procedures, functions e triggers.
• Conhecimento em PL/SQL (Oracle) e PL/pgSQL (PostgreSQL).
• Administração de banco de dados em ambientes de desenvolvimento, homologação e produção.
• Versionamento de banco de dados utilizando Liquibase ou ferramenta equivalente.
• Experiência com ElasticSearch, incluindo indexação de dados, consultas e apoio à análise de informações.
• Conhecimento em estrutura de armazenamento físico, incluindo tablespaces (Oracle), schemas, índices, particionamento e estratégias de organização de dados.
• Avaliação e otimização de desempenho do banco de dados, com análise de planos de execução.
• Aplicação de boas práticas de segurança, integridade e consistência dos dados.
Conhecimentos Desejáveis/Diferenciais:
• Experiência com ambientes de alta volumetria de dados.
• Experiência em projetos do setor público ou ambientes regulados.
• Certificações Oracle ou PostgreSQL.
• Pós-graduação na área de Banco de Dados ou correlatas.
• Experiência com sistemas governamentais ou do judiciário (integração com PJe).
• Inglês para leitura e escrita técnica.
Habilidades Comportamentais/Soft Skills:
• Forte capacidade analítica e atenção a detalhes.
• Organização e responsabilidade na administração de ambientes críticos.
• Comunicação clara com equipes técnicas e funcionais.
• Proatividade na identificação e solução de problemas.
• Capacidade de seguir normas, processos e diretrizes estabelecidas.
Atribuições e Responsabilidades a serem desempenhadas:
Administração e Governança de Banco de Dados
• Instalação, configuração e upgrade de Sistemas de Gerenciamento de Base de Dados Oracle e produtos relacionados como o SGBD single-instance e RAC, Enterprise Manager, Data Guard e Golden Gate.
• Administrar os bancos de dados dos projetos em Oracle e PostgreSQL, garantindo disponibilidade, confiabilidade e integridade das informações.
• Gerenciar usuários, perfis, roles e privilégios de acesso.
• Monitorar o uso de recursos e crescimento dos bancos de dados, atuando preventivamente.
• Assegurar aderência aos padrões técnicos, normativos internos e premissas definidas pelo cliente.
• Criar e manter políticas e procedimentos de Backup e Recovery efetivos.
• Planejar o crescimento e capacidade das bases de dados.
Modelagem e Estruturação de Dados
• Construir, manter e evoluir o modelo de dados dos sistemas.
• Detalhar as tabelas e estruturas do banco de dados, definindo layout de armazenamento físico, índices, constraints e relacionamentos.
• Garantir alinhamento entre o modelo de dados, regras de negócio e diretrizes técnicas do projeto.
Consultas, Performance e Otimização
• Executar, revisar e otimizar consultas SQL, visando melhor desempenho e menor consumo de recursos.
• Analisar planos de execução (EXPLAIN PLAN, EXPLAIN ANALYZE).
• Atuar na otimização de procedures, functions, views e scripts SQL.
• Propor melhorias estruturais, como ajustes de índices, particionamento e reorganização de dados.
Versionamento e Integração com Desenvolvimento
• Implementar e manter o versionamento de banco de dados com Liquibase, garantindo rastreabilidade e controle das mudanças.
• Atuar em conjunto com equipes de desenvolvimento para garantir consistência entre código da aplicação e banco de dados.
• Apoiar processos de evolução, manutenção e correção de estruturas de dados ao longo do ciclo de vida do projeto.
Suporte Técnico e Conformidade
• Atuar na análise e resolução de incidentes relacionados a banco de dados.
• Documentar modelos, padrões, estruturas e decisões técnicas.
• Garantir que as soluções adotadas estejam em conformidade com padrões internos, normativos do cliente e boas práticas de mercado.
Informações sobre o Contrato
Remuneração: A combinar.
Carga Horária: 20h semanais - Segunda a Sexta - das 14:00 às 18:00.
Benefícios:
Acesso à cursos em plataformas de ensino